Product details
Overview
PBSS5250THR from Nexperia is a PNP low VCEsat transistor in SOT23 package, designed for high-efficiency switching in power management and DC-DC conversion circuits. It delivers 50 V VCEO, −2 A continuous collector current, 150 mΩ RCEsat at IC = −2 A / IB = −200 mA, and operates up to 175 °C junction temperature-enabling compact, thermally robust load switching in battery-powered and industrial control systems.
For engineers reviewing the PBSS5250THR datasheet, PBSS5250THR pinout, PBSS5250THR application, or PBSS5250THR equivalent, key selection criteria include verified low saturation resistance, thermal derating behavior on FR4 PCBs, safe operating area under pulsed inductive loads, and compatibility with 3.3 V/5 V base drive in peripheral driver configurations.
Technical Context
This PNP bipolar transistor uses epitaxial planar technology optimized for low saturation voltage and high current gain at elevated collector currents. Its hFE ≥ 130 at IC = −2 A ensures reliable saturation with modest base drive (IB = −100 mA), while VCEsat ≤ −300 mV at IC = −2 A / IB = −100 mA minimizes conduction loss in high-duty-cycle switches.
Thermal design is supported by four documented Rth(j-a) values (215–417 K/W) depending on PCB copper layer count and collector pad area, and transient thermal impedance curves confirm stable operation under 1 ms pulses up to 3 A peak. The device is non-automotive qualified and rated for −55 °C to +175 °C ambient operation.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| VCEO | −50 V - Maximum blocking voltage across collector-emitter with base open; defines maximum supply rail compatibility in high-side switch topologies. |
| IC | −2 A - Continuous DC collector current rating; supports sustained load switching in battery chargers and DC-DC output stages. |
| RCEsat | 150 mΩ - Measured at IC = −2 A / IB = −200 mA; enables <150 mW conduction loss at full load, reducing thermal stress on small PCB footprints. |
| hFE | 130 min - DC current gain at IC = −2 A / VCE = −2 V; ensures deep saturation with base current ≤5% of collector current. |
| Tj max | 175 °C - Maximum junction temperature; allows operation in sealed enclosures or high-ambient industrial environments without forced cooling. |
| VBEsat | −1.1 V - Base-emitter saturation voltage at IC = −2 A / IB = −100 mA; determines minimum base drive voltage required for full turn-on. |
Pinout & Package
SOT23 (TO-236AB) plastic surface-mount package: 2.9 mm × 1.3 mm × 1.0 mm body, 1.9 mm lead pitch, 3-terminal configuration with gull-wing leads. Designed for reflow and wave soldering per IPC-7095 guidelines.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| Base (B) | Control input requiring negative bias relative to emitter; drives transistor into saturation with IB ≥ −100 mA for full IC = −2 A conduction. |
| 2 | Emitter (E) | Common reference terminal for PNP topology; connects to higher-potential rail (e.g., battery positive); carries full load current and sets VBE reference. |
| 3 | Collector (C) | Switched output terminal; connects to load; must be routed with adequate copper area to manage thermal resistance (Rth(j-sp) = 75 K/W). |

FAQ
What is the maximum allowable base current for continuous operation?
The absolute maximum base current is −300 mA per datasheet limiting values. For reliable long-term operation, base current should be limited to ≤−200 mA under continuous DC conditions to maintain junction temperature within 175 °C, especially when mounted on standard 2-layer FR4 PCBs with minimal copper area.
Can PBSS5250THR replace a MOSFET in high-side switching applications?
Yes, but with trade-offs: it offers lower gate-drive complexity than PMOS (no level shifter needed) and better SOA under inductive switching than many small-signal MOSFETs. However, its −1.1 V VBEsat requires more base drive power than MOSFET gate charge, and it lacks the near-zero static gate current of MOSFETs.
How does thermal performance vary between 2-layer and 4-layer PCB mounting?
Rth(j-a) improves from 417 K/W (2-layer, standard footprint) to 215 K/W (4-layer, 1 cm² collector pad), enabling ~2.3× higher continuous power dissipation. At IC = −2 A, this translates to ~120 mW vs. ~280 mW allowable Ptot before exceeding 175 °C junction temperature.
Is PBSS5250THR suitable for automotive applications?
No. Per revision history v.3 (20241008), this part was explicitly changed to non-automotive status. It is not AEC-Q101 qualified, lacks automotive-grade screening, and has no guaranteed performance over automotive temperature ranges or lifetime requirements. Use only in industrial, consumer, or commercial equipment.
